SecretClientOptions interface
Los parámetros opcionales aceptados por KeyVault KeyClient
- Extends
Propiedades
| disable |
Si desactivar la verificación de que el recurso de desafío de autenticación coincide con el dominio de Key Vault. El valor predeterminado es false. |
| service |
Las versiones aceptadas de la API de servicio de KeyVault. |
Propiedades heredadas
| additional |
Directivas adicionales que se van a incluir en la canalización HTTP. |
| agent | Opciones para configurar la instancia del agente para las solicitudes salientes |
| allow |
Establézcalo en true si la solicitud se envía a través de HTTP en lugar de HTTPS. |
| http |
HttpClient que se usará para enviar solicitudes HTTP. |
| keep |
Opciones para configurar el comportamiento de mantener vivo las conexiones HTTP. |
| proxy |
Opciones para configurar un proxy para las solicitudes salientes. |
| redirect |
Opciones para controlar las respuestas de redirección. |
| retry |
Opciones que controlan cómo reintentar las solicitudes con errores. |
| telemetry |
Opciones para establecer información de seguimiento y telemetría comunes en las solicitudes salientes. |
| tls |
Opciones para configurar la autenticación TLS |
| user |
Opciones para agregar detalles del agente de usuario a las solicitudes salientes. |
Detalles de las propiedades
disableChallengeResourceVerification
Si desactivar la verificación de que el recurso de desafío de autenticación coincide con el dominio de Key Vault. El valor predeterminado es false.
disableChallengeResourceVerification?: boolean
Valor de propiedad
boolean
serviceVersion
Las versiones aceptadas de la API de servicio de KeyVault.
serviceVersion?: "7.0" | "7.1" | "7.2" | "7.3" | "7.4" | "7.5" | "7.6" | "2025-07-01"
Valor de propiedad
"7.0" | "7.1" | "7.2" | "7.3" | "7.4" | "7.5" | "7.6" | "2025-07-01"
Detalles de las propiedades heredadas
additionalPolicies
Directivas adicionales que se van a incluir en la canalización HTTP.
additionalPolicies?: AdditionalPolicyConfig[]
Valor de propiedad
heredado de ExtendedCommonClientOptions.additionalPolicies
agent
Opciones para configurar la instancia del agente para las solicitudes salientes
agent?: Agent
Valor de propiedad
Heredado de ExtendedCommonClientOptions.agent
allowInsecureConnection
Establézcalo en true si la solicitud se envía a través de HTTP en lugar de HTTPS.
allowInsecureConnection?: boolean
Valor de propiedad
boolean
heredado de ExtendedCommonClientOptions.allowInsecureConnection
httpClient
HttpClient que se usará para enviar solicitudes HTTP.
httpClient?: HttpClient
Valor de propiedad
heredado de ExtendedCommonClientOptions.httpClient
keepAliveOptions
Opciones para configurar el comportamiento de mantener vivo las conexiones HTTP.
keepAliveOptions?: KeepAliveOptions
Valor de propiedad
heredado de ExtendedCommonClientOptions.keepAliveOptions
proxyOptions
Opciones para configurar un proxy para las solicitudes salientes.
proxyOptions?: ProxySettings
Valor de propiedad
Heredado de ExtendedCommonClientOptions.proxyOptions
redirectOptions
Opciones para controlar las respuestas de redirección.
redirectOptions?: RedirectPolicyOptions & RedirectOptions
Valor de propiedad
Heredado de ExtendedCommonClientOptions.redirectOptions
retryOptions
Opciones que controlan cómo reintentar las solicitudes con errores.
retryOptions?: PipelineRetryOptions
Valor de propiedad
heredado de ExtendedCommonClientOptions.retryOptions
telemetryOptions
Opciones para establecer información de seguimiento y telemetría comunes en las solicitudes salientes.
telemetryOptions?: TelemetryOptions
Valor de propiedad
Heredado de ExtendedCommonClientOptions.telemetryOptions
tlsOptions
Opciones para configurar la autenticación TLS
tlsOptions?: TlsSettings
Valor de propiedad
heredado de ExtendedCommonClientOptions.tlsOptions
userAgentOptions
Opciones para agregar detalles del agente de usuario a las solicitudes salientes.
userAgentOptions?: UserAgentPolicyOptions
Valor de propiedad
heredado de ExtendedCommonClientOptions.userAgentOptions